Shinji Takahashi travels the world with his Aunt Yui on their ship the Good Tern, finding rare artifacts and treasures for her business. But one day when they are visiting the small village of Abenge in Africa, Shinji comes across an idol in a dusty shop at the edge of the market, not realizing the power that it holds. He’s captured by the Hightower Corporation, who want to use the relic for their own sinister purposes, but the relic turns itself into a tattoo— the Mark of the Coatl. Shinji, with the help of his friend Lucy and her robot mouse Tinker, must return the Coatl to its rightful place before Hightower gets their hands on it— or risk losing the Coatls’ magic forever. I liked this book because it was fast-paced and exciting, making every page an adventure! It was rich with a lot of myths and lore connected to Mesoamerica, tying in well with the characters and how they fit into the storyline. I really liked the characters from the Society of Explorers and Adventurers and Lucy, whose powers I thought were cool. I would recommend this book to anyone looking for a rich, myth-woven adventure!
